Output 8677517942b63cd5f94f3869d81279299735408e8e2ad42427a17e055e3880c3:0

value
4007993
script pubkey
OP_0 OP_PUSHBYTES_20 afb40f74804c649581816402cda4863e5432bd07
address
bc1q476q7ayqf3jftqvpvspvmfyx8e2r90g85s3un9
transaction
8677517942b63cd5f94f3869d81279299735408e8e2ad42427a17e055e3880c3